Transaction 05aef34455f3a614742111da0e290c200fc7544a094d7040440fca9364031098
1 Input
1 Output
-
05aef34455f3a614742111da0e290c200fc7544a094d7040440fca9364031098:0
- value
- 171908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cfa954dc19ab24918a088856d6759b47fb3abb2c OP_EQUAL
- address
- 3Ld2ecMaZvwtyfjiSFxNZSwEY6ZgH8qBB5